PORTLAND, Maine, USA: University of New England’s dental hygiene program is celebrating 50 years since the graduation of its first class in 1963. A reception was held May 1 on the Portland campus, hosted by Dental Hygiene Program Director Bunny Mills from the Class of 1976. The event featured a video researched and coordinated by Lauren Cummings of the Class of 2013.
Accredited by the American Dental Association, students of UNE’s dental hygiene program are provided with an education that prepares them for distinctive dental hygiene careers. Third- and fourth-year students, under the close supervision of quality faculty, spend 12 to 16 hours per week providing direct patient care in the on-campus clinic to approximately 5,000 patients of all ages each year.
UNE offers both a four-year bachelor of science degree in dental hygiene and a bachelor of science completion degree program, where students develop a thorough knowledge of dental hygiene theories and practices, study the important aspects of dental hygiene care and learn how to prevent oral disease. The program is part of UNE’s Westbrook College of Health Professions.
